RECOVERY SOLUTIONS OF NORTHEAST OHIO, founded in 2019, is a community nonprofit in the Housing & Shelter sector that reported $1.1M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 34%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$1.3M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 15% operating deficit.

Mission

The mission of RSNEO is to provide a safe, supportive and drug-free environment for individuals to have the best opportunity for recovery and for transition to productive members of the society.
